I’m going to be honest, I was absolutely drawn into this book by its cover. Then I saw it was written by Marley Valentine and automatically had to read it.

It was heartbreaking at times but there was also humor in moments that helped break up the tears. Miscommunication is a huge part of this book and also cheating. Unfortunately it is heavy cheating between the two MC’s. Also you get a huge backstory of the fiancé Elena in the book. While it is nice she isn’t brushed under the rug, it’s and MM book so I wished to see more of the back story between the two.

All in all a good book! The author has a unique writing style that I thoroughly enjoy!

This book was sooo cute!! I seriously love friends to lovers. It just makes my heart sing with how precious it can be.

There were just 2 problems I had with this book. One being the amnesia plot line. I didn't know I hated amnesia romances until now. But dang, it pissed me off.

And 2, sometimes I mixed up the 2 POV's of Gael and Jordan. Just sometimes their voices kind of clashed and I'd forget who's POV I was reading.

But other than that, this was such a good friends to lovers story that left my heart... well... aching.
